In observing class today, I noticed the struggle for some to bring their leg through from Down Dog to Warrior 1. It was in the sweep of stepping one foot between the hands without floating the knee outside the ribs, by-passing the knee to chest movement. What happens? Tight hamstrings? Weakness of abs? Weakness of hip flexors? Habit? Large chest? All can be the answer or just one. Practice the movement of drawing the knee foward to the chest and aim the foot forward! Try not to open the hip. Then keep practicing!
